In this solo episode of Literacy in Color, we’re cutting through the confusion around sight words, high-frequency words, and orthographic mapping. You’ll get a clear, research-backed understanding of how the brain actually learns words — and why traditional memorization strategies just don’t cut it.

Michelle breaks down why every word "wants to grow up and become a sight word" and shares how teachers can make smart instructional moves that build strong, fluent readers by honoring what we know from the Science of Reading.

If you’ve ever wondered:

  • Should I still send home sight word flashcards?
  • What’s orthographic mapping actually mean?
  • How can I organize my high-frequency instruction around phonics skills?

...this episode will answer ALL of that (and more!) in a practical, empowering way.

Key Takeaways:

  • The difference between sight words and high-frequency words (hint: they're not the same)
  • What orthographic mapping is—and why it’s not an activity
  • How words become mapped for instant recognition
  • Why explicit instruction—not memorization—is key to building fluent readers
  • How to group high-frequency words by phonics features for better transfer and mastery
